Released in 1991, JFK is a thriller, drama and history film directed by Oliver Stone, running about 189 minutes. “The story that won't go away.” — that tagline sets the tone.
What it’s about. Follows the investigation into the assassination of President John F. Kennedy led by New Orleans district attorney Jim Garrison.
Who’s in it. JFK stars Kevin Costner as Jim Garrison, Tommy Lee Jones as Clay Shaw / Clay Bertrand, Gary Oldman as Lee Harvey Oswald and Kevin Bacon as Willie O'Keefe, among others.
How it landed. With an audience score of 7.6/10, JFK has been warmly received by audiences. It went on to earn $205.4M at the box office.
